Me: Oh no!  I’m so sorry to hear you’re not feeling well 😢 Sunday school was really good.  Dawn facilitated some great discussion.  Johny Meuchel was very concerned that he has family members that he’s afraid won’t make it to the celestial kingdom because they’re not members of our church. They’re really good, kind, honest people. What happens to them?  I responded directly to his question. I told him I believe we need to stop thinking of the degrees of glory as a destination. Instead, we need to think of them as degrees of relationship with Jesus. I think we get caught up in the complexities of the different glories. I believe this isn’t destination based... it’s a way of living right now 😌Later, after class I told him I don’t believe in an all or nothing God. I believe we will be blown away with how merciful and full of Grace our Savior is. So if the glories aren’t destination based what it all boils down to is How much Jesus do you want 😉✨ 💝
